Climate change is inspiring the ultimate scary movies | Ryan Gilbey

9 hours ago | The Guardian - Film News | See recent The Guardian - Film News news »

Disaster film-makers struggling to compete with the realities of the post-9/11 world have, in global warming, found the perfect plot device

It may be the start of a new year, but as far as cinema is concerned that doesn't mean it can't also be the end of the world. Even before January is out, audiences will have been given two gruelling visions of the future from which to choose. You can experience your dystopian forecast in moderately Hollywood-friendly form in The Book of Eli, in which Denzel Washington battles unwashed marauding types in a harsh futuristic landscape. Or you can take your medicine straight in the form of The Road, an adaptation of Cormac McCarthy's novel about a father and son trudging through a world scarred by environmental collapse.

Long before such films, or recent animated equivalents like Wall-e or 9, we have harboured a cultural compulsion to imagine our collective demise. »
